GO FOR A WALK!
Simply walk around our great area. You will immediately begin to notice lots of things which will prompt lots of questions. Often the past is barely visible beneath new roofs or shopfronts. What has happened to the old schools and churches? — sometimes they become community centres and homes, sometimes they become showrooms and small factories. What is the history of your local park. Was it created by the local council or was it donated by a local benefactor many years ago?
